Confucius Institute at the University of Guadalajara was invited to participate in the Chinese New Year Celebration of the No.5 High School of Guadalajara University

On February 14th, the Confucius Institute at the University of Guadalajara was invited to the No.5 High School of the University of Guadalajara to participate in the Chinese New Year Celebration of 2024 Year of the Dragon, and had in-depth communications with the school staff and students of the No.5 High School.

The delegation from the Confucius Institute were warmly received by the school leaders and Chinese teachers of the No.5 High School, and both sides had in-depth discussions on Chinese language teaching and development, the relationship between China and Mexico, and other topics. José Manuel Jurado Parres, the principal of the No.5 High School , expressed his strong support for Chinese language teaching. On behalf of the Confucius Institute, Wei Shuhua, the Chinese Director of the Confucius Institute, presented the school with a silk scroll painting, expressing the beautiful vision of friendly exchanges between the both sides and the blessing of the New Year of the Dragon. Afterwards, everyone came to the school's playground to watch the wonderful lion dance and martial arts performance.

In the afternoon, representatives of the Confucius Institute held a joint party in the characteristics of Chinese traditional culture with the students in the unique Chinese classroom of the No.5 High School. Yu Yehui, a teacher from the Confucius Institute introduced the Chinese tea culture to the students and teachers, demonstrated how to make tea, and invited everyone to experience it by themselves, during the time, the students were immersed in the unique charm of the Chinese tea ceremony. Huang Yanxiao, another teacher from the Confucius Institute brought Chinese folk dance and classical dance to the audience, and led them to learn the Dai dance Fung-tailed Bamboo under the Moonlight with the live accompaniment music of the lute.

The No.5 High School of the University of Guadalajara is the first model high school to promote Chinese language courses among the dozens of high schools of the University of Guadalajara, and in 2023, two Chinese language teachers and five students of the school went China and participated in the exchange program of the Confucius Institute. Through the Spring Festival Celebration, the teachers and students of Confucius Institute and the No.5 High School deepened their cultural exchanges, enhanced their friendship, and laid a solid foundation for their future cooperation of Chinese language teaching.
